I'm glad you posted that up because I had a DuraMileage module that I had on my truck that I pulled off because of Gale's video. I believe that it's the same tech as the Stealth and Dr. Performance modules. I never had better fuel mileage and my regen intervals decreased in mileage because of the over fueling. IMHO, save your money because the claims aren't true. Don't waste your money like I did. If you want to tune your truck with emissions on, look into 5Star or DP-Tuner that actually tune not only the truck, but the transmission as well.
